The United States (US) Functional Apparel Market was estimated at USD 249 Million in 2025 and is projected to reach USD 292 Million by 2032, growing at a CAGR of 2.3% from 2026 to 2032. This growth trajectory is primarily fueled by heightened consumer interest in performance-oriented clothing that offers comfort and versatility for various activities. The continuous evolution of materials and technology, combined with rising health consciousness, is driving consumers toward functional apparel as a practical solution for their lifestyle needs.

In recent years, the US Functional Apparel Market has gained significant momentum, buoyed by the athleisure trend and an increasing focus on wellness. Looking ahead, this market is expected to sustain its growth, with innovations in fabric technology and sustainable practices becoming more pronounced. As consumers search for apparel that fits both their active pursuits and daily lives, brands are adapting to meet these evolving demands.
Moreover, the shift toward sustainable and eco-friendly materials is reshaping the marketplace. With consumers increasingly valuing ethical production, companies are responding with innovations that not only enhance performance but also minimize environmental impact. This creates a dynamic interplay between function, style, and sustainability, establishing the foundation for future growth in the market.
Despite its promising outlook, the US Functional Apparel Market faces several restraints that can impede growth. Intensifying competition from both established brands and new entrants heightens the necessity for continuous innovation. Furthermore, fluctuating manufacturing costs associated with advanced materials and technologies challenge profitability. There is also a notable shift in consumer preferences towards more sustainable and ethically produced clothing, which demands significant investment in eco-friendly practices. Retailers must find ways to effectively market and differentiate their products in a crowded landscape while ensuring high standards of quality to meet rising consumer expectations.
The US Functional Apparel Market is currently witnessing several key trends that are shaping consumer behavior and product development. A significant trend is the growing preference for athleisure, where clothing designed for athletic purposes is seamlessly blending into everyday fashion. This trend underscores the importance of versatility in functional apparel.
Additionally, the market is increasingly gravitating toward sustainable materials, such as recycled polyester and organic cotton. Innovative technologies, such as moisture-wicking fabrics and odor control treatments, are becoming standard features, enhancing the appeal of functional apparel. Brands are also prioritizing inclusive sizing, ensuring that their offerings cater to diverse body types and preferences, further expanding their market reach.

Government policies impacting the US Functional Apparel Market primarily focus on ensuring product safety and promoting sustainable practices. The Federal Trade Commission (FTC) plays a crucial role in regulating labeling standards, ensuring that consumers receive accurate information regarding the performance and claims of functional apparel. Additionally, agencies like the Environmental Protection Agency (EPA) set forth guidelines to minimize the environmental impact of textile production, encouraging manufacturers to adopt sustainable practices. Trade policies also affect the import and export of functional apparel products, further shaping the competitive landscape.

Export potential enables firms to identify high-growth global markets with greater confidence by combining advanced trade intelligence with a structured quantitative methodology. The framework analyzes emerging demand trends and country-level import patterns while integrating macroeconomic and trade datasets such as GDP and population forecasts, bilateral import–export flows, tariff structures, elasticity differentials between developed and developing economies, geographic distance, and import demand projections. Using weighted trade values from 2020–2024 as the base period to project country-to-country export potential for 2030, these inputs are operationalized through calculated drivers such as gravity model parameters, tariff impact factors, and projected GDP per-capita growth. Through an analysis of hidden potentials, demand hotspots, and market conditions that are most favorable to success, this method enables firms to focus on target countries, maximize returns, and global expansion with data, backed by accuracy.
By factoring in the projected importer demand gap that is currently unmet and could be potential opportunity, it identifies the potential for the Exporter (Country) among 190 countries, against the general trade analysis, which identifies the biggest importer or exporter.
